1. Reasons why dogs eat trash cans

1. Out of boredom

Dogs who are alone at home will rummage through the trash cans. It’s not that they particularly like garbage, but that the house is too boring and they want to do something that they can’t do under the supervision of their owners. Dogs like smelly things. For example, there are leftover bones or other scented things in the trash can that attract dogs to dig through them. Dog owners should be reminded that if they don’t like your dog digging through the trash can, don’t throw leftover bones, bread bags, and anything that smells like food in the trash can; otherwise, just put them in the trash can. Place the trash can out of reach of dogs, otherwise they will get sick and have diarrhea if they eat something they shouldn't.

2. Legacy habits

In the past, dogs had to look for food everywhere in order to survive, so they would not miss anything that could solve their hunger problem. For this innate habit, we can only improve it through ordinary education.

Things in the garbage are quite attractive to dogs, even more so than the special dog toys you buy for them. No matter what is thrown away, it has a strong smell. For them, the trash can is more like a cornucopia of countless "treasures". To improve this problem, owners should train more when they are at home.
